Body

Origins and Family

Gérard Edelinck was born in Antwerp[2]. He was born on +1640-10-20T00:00:00Z[3].

Education

Gérard Edelinck studied under François de Poilly[28].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include painter[6], printmaker[7], and copper engraver[8]. Gérard Edelinck's field of work was painting[14]. A notable student of him was Jean Edelinck[15].

Personal Life

Gérard Edelinck was married to Magdeleine Regnesson[10]. A child of him was Nicolas Edelinck[11].

Death and Burial

Gérard Edelinck died on +1707-04-02T00:00:00Z[5]. He passed away in Paris[4].
